Transaction 506ba2093dbb5f7d8e778ec15ddbc1ef970746c4f8ea753da7b2e77a34d90bb2

1 Input
2 Outputs
  • 506ba2093dbb5f7d8e778ec15ddbc1ef970746c4f8ea753da7b2e77a34d90bb2:0
  • value  1970000
    address  1CfbYE7QP44JLBBcppVvmZayvEP5pSM1Z7
  • 506ba2093dbb5f7d8e778ec15ddbc1ef970746c4f8ea753da7b2e77a34d90bb2:1
  • value  11288619
    address  38onWkZZUCbdpD4NfJWWCwT3oWtERAMRtw